Frankfurt, the vibrant financial hub of Germany, is not only known for its impressive skyline and robust economy but also for its thriving biofood scene. If you're a conscious traveler who prioritizes sustainability and organic living, a trip to Frankfurt will not only delight your taste buds but also nourish your commitment to eco-friendly practices.
One of the best ways to immerse yourself in Frankfurt's biofood culture is by visiting its local markets. The Kleinmarkthalle, a bustling indoor market in the heart of the city, is a paradise for foodies seeking fresh and organic produce. Here, you can browse through a colorful array of fruits, vegetables, cheeses, meats, and baked goods â all sourced from local producers who prioritize sustainable farming practices.
For a true farm-to-table experience, venture out to the surrounding countryside of Frankfurt to visit organic farms and vineyards. Many of these family-owned establishments offer guided tours and tasting experiences, allowing you to learn about the production process while sampling delicious and responsibly sourced food and wine.
In addition to exploring Frankfurt's markets and farms, be sure to dine at the city's biofood restaurants and cafes. From cozy bistros serving seasonal dishes made with locally sourced ingredients to trendy vegan eateries offering innovative plant-based creations, Frankfurt has a diverse culinary landscape that caters to every eco-conscious palate.
To further enhance your biofood travel experience in Frankfurt, consider participating in cooking classes or food workshops focused on sustainable and organic cooking practices. You'll not only learn valuable skills and techniques but also gain a deeper appreciation for the connection between food, health, and the environment.
As you navigate Frankfurt's biofood scene, remember to support businesses that share your values and commitment to sustainability. By choosing to eat and shop ethically, you're not only nourishing your body but also contributing to a more eco-friendly and conscious food system.
In conclusion, a biofood travel experience in Frankfurt is a feast for the senses and a celebration of mindful eating. Embrace the city's vibrant food culture, support local farmers and producers, and savor the delicious flavors of sustainable living.
